NOVELTY – The process for obtaining inulin concentrate (fructose polysaccharide) involves reduction of temperature and physical separation. Tubercles of chicory are used as raw material and the following stages are involved in the process: (a) pre-processing; (b) extraction; (c) separation; (d) freezing; (e) de freezing; (f) separation; (g) drying; and (h) packing. USE – For obtaining inulin concentrate (fructose polysaccharide). DESCRIPTION OF DRAWING(S) – The drawing provides a block diagram of the details of the process.
